IXSIR Winery, named after the Arabic word 'Iksir' meaning 'Elixir,' embodies the pursuit of the purest form of winemaking akin to a secret potion granting eternal youth and love. At the heart of IXSIR's vision lies the rediscovery of Lebanon's forgotten terroirs. These vineyards, meticulously cultivated with a focus on sustainable agriculture, span the Lebanese mountains and their clay-calcareous and limestone soils, stretching from Batroun to Jezzine. Enriched by unique microclimates, IXSIR's vineyards reach an impressive altitude of 1,800 meters, standing as the highest in the Northern Hemisphere. IXSIR winery was named by CNN as one of the greenest building in the world, and won the international Architizer A+ Award as well as the Good Green Design award and the Green Mind MENA Award.

Standing at an impressive altitude of 1,800 meters, the highest in the Northern Hemisphere, IXSIR Winery crafts exceptional wines, including their Altitudes Blanc, a blend of Obeideh, Muscat, and Viognier. Boasting distinctive aromas of oranges, jasmine, honeysuckle, and mango, this wine offers a superbly balanced experience with freshness, texture, and an elegant, enduring finish.
